Full Analysis
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ill directs the agent to utilize standard Linux administrative utilities (such as lspci, numactl, taskset, ip, and systemctl) alongside NVIDIA-specific platform tools (like flint, mlxconfig, and bfb-install). These tools are employed for hardware discovery, resource binding, and deployment operations consistent with the skill's stated purpose.
  • [SAFE]: The skill explicitly defines a 'smoke-before-bulk' safety strategy to prevent system instability during initial deployment. It also mandates an 'assume-high-stakes' posture for failed processes, requiring manual intervention instead of allowing unsupervised restart loops. Furthermore, the instructions emphasize using live system data over hardcoded or guessed hardware identifiers, significantly reducing the risk of misconfiguration or unauthorized device access.
